The Foster Wheeler-designed US $950 million Oryx gas-to-liquids (GTL) plant at Ras Laffan Industrial City, Qatar, has been officially inaugurated by His Highness, Sheikh Hamad Bin Khalifa Al-Thani, Emir of the State of Qatar The ceremony was attended by Foster Wheeler and other dignitaries and guests from Qatar and abroad

Oryx GTL is a joint venture between state-owned Qatar Petroleum (51%) and South African-based petrochemical company, Sasol (49%).

Foster Wheeler's UK subsidiary, Foster Wheeler Energy, part of its Global Engineering and Construction Group, is the engineering partner for Sasol's GTL projects and was part of the multi-company project management team comprising Qatar Petroleum, Sasol and Foster Wheeler for this groundbreaking project.

The Oryx GTL plant is a "world first": the first plant to convert natural gas to liquid fuel at commercial scale.

It uses the proprietary, low-temperature Sasol Slurry Phase Distillate (SPD ) process that is based on Fischer-Tropsch technology.

9350Ml per day of lean natural gas from Qatar's North Gas Field in the Gulf provided the feedstock to produce a planned 34,000 barrels per day of liquids.

This will comprise 24,000 barrels per day of diesel, 9,000 barrels per day of naphtha and 1000 barrels per day of liquefied petroleum gas.

Foster Wheeler's involvement started with an initial conceptual analysis and development of the GTL process for Sasol in 1998.

This work developed into feasibility and front-end engineering design work for the Oryx GTL facility and completion of the engineering, procurement and construction (EPC) bid evaluation in December 2002.

The EPC contract was awarded in March 2003 and Foster Wheeler has continued to support the project as part of the team managing the EPC contractor.
